The Golden Section by Pernille Rygg

Moving between the world of violent pornographic art and the happy life she shares with her husband and daughter, Igi must follow a dangerous and shocking path to the truth. An Igi Heitman mystery.
Curl up with a stiff whiskey and lose yourself in the inquiring mind of Igi Heitmann, a heroine of Smilla-like unconventionality * Guardian *
Her distinctive voice brings a special quality to the story she tells in The Golden Section.. Full of powerful descriptive passages, this is a book which stays in the memory * Sunday Telegraph *
Pernille Rygg is one of the 'hard-boiled' school, critical of society, whose roots are deep in the worlds of Hammett and Chandler -- Fredrikstad Blad
Pernille Rygg was born in 1963. She has studied history and ethnology, for several years worked as a set painter for film companies and for the Norwegian Broadcasting Company. She is also the author of The Butterfly Effect.
